From mboxrd@z Thu Jan 1 00:00:00 1970 From: Dave Airlie Subject: [PATCH] amdgpu/dc: remove wait_reg/wait_reg_func interfaces. Date: Thu, 28 Sep 2017 13:29:32 +1000 Message-ID: <20170928032932.9324-1-airlied@gmail.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: List-Id: Discussion list for AMD gfx List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: amd-gfx-bounces-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org Sender: "amd-gfx" To: amd-gfx-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org RnJvbTogRGF2ZSBBaXJsaWUgPGFpcmxpZWRAcmVkaGF0LmNvbT4KClRoZXNlIGFyZW4ndCB1c2Vk IGluIHRoZSB0cmVlIGFueXdoZXJlLCBhbmQgdGhlcmUgaXMgYSBUT0RPLgoKU2lnbmVkLW9mZi1i eTogRGF2ZSBBaXJsaWUgPGFpcmxpZWRAcmVkaGF0LmNvbT4KLS0tCiBkcml2ZXJzL2dwdS9kcm0v YW1kL2Rpc3BsYXkvZGMvZG1fc2VydmljZXMuaCB8IDQ2IC0tLS0tLS0tLS0tLS0tLS0tLS0tLS0t LS0tLS0KIDEgZmlsZSBjaGFuZ2VkLCA0NiBkZWxldGlvbnMoLSkKCmRpZmYgLS1naXQgYS9kcml2 ZXJzL2dwdS9kcm0vYW1kL2Rpc3BsYXkvZGMvZG1fc2VydmljZXMuaCBiL2RyaXZlcnMvZ3B1L2Ry bS9hbWQvZGlzcGxheS9kYy9kbV9zZXJ2aWNlcy5oCmluZGV4IGM5NzZlMmEuLjgxNjYwMjcgMTAw NjQ0Ci0tLSBhL2RyaXZlcnMvZ3B1L2RybS9hbWQvZGlzcGxheS9kYy9kbV9zZXJ2aWNlcy5oCisr KyBiL2RyaXZlcnMvZ3B1L2RybS9hbWQvZGlzcGxheS9kYy9kbV9zZXJ2aWNlcy5oCkBAIC0yMzYs NTIgKzIzNiw2IEBAIHVuc2lnbmVkIGludCBnZW5lcmljX3JlZ193YWl0KGNvbnN0IHN0cnVjdCBk Y19jb250ZXh0ICpjdHgsCiAJCWJsb2NrICMjIHJlZ19udW0gIyMgXyAjIyByZWdfbmFtZSAjIyBf XyAjIyByZWdfZmllbGQgIyMgX01BU0ssXAogCQlibG9jayAjIyByZWdfbnVtICMjIF8gIyMgcmVn X25hbWUgIyMgX18gIyMgcmVnX2ZpZWxkICMjIF9fU0hJRlQpCiAKLS8qIFRPRE8gZ2V0IHJpZCBv ZiB0aGlzIHBvcyovCi1zdGF0aWMgaW5saW5lIGJvb2wgd2FpdF9yZWdfZnVuYygKLQljb25zdCBz dHJ1Y3QgZGNfY29udGV4dCAqY3R4LAotCXVpbnQzMl90IGFkZHIsCi0JdWludDMyX3QgbWFzaywK LQl1aW50OF90IHNoaWZ0LAotCXVpbnQzMl90IGNvbmRpdGlvbl92YWx1ZSwKLQl1bnNpZ25lZCBp bnQgaW50ZXJ2YWxfdXMsCi0JdW5zaWduZWQgaW50IHRpbWVvdXRfdXMpCi17Ci0JdWludDMyX3Qg ZmllbGRfdmFsdWU7Ci0JdWludDMyX3QgcmVnX3ZhbDsKLQl1bnNpZ25lZCBpbnQgY291bnQgPSAw OwotCi0JaWYgKElTX0ZQR0FfTUFYSU1VU19EQyhjdHgtPmRjZV9lbnZpcm9ubWVudCkpCi0JCXRp bWVvdXRfdXMgKj0gNjU1OyAgLyogNjU1MyBnaXZlIGFib3V0IDMwIHNlY29uZCBiZWZvcmUgdGlt ZSBvdXQgKi8KLQotCWRvIHsKLQkJLyogdHJ5IG9uY2Ugd2l0aG91dCBzbGVlcGluZyAqLwotCQlp ZiAoY291bnQgPiAwKSB7Ci0JCQlpZiAoaW50ZXJ2YWxfdXMgPj0gMTAwMCkKLQkJCQltc2xlZXAo aW50ZXJ2YWxfdXMvMTAwMCk7Ci0JCQllbHNlCi0JCQkJdWRlbGF5KGludGVydmFsX3VzKTsKLQkJ fQotCQlyZWdfdmFsID0gZG1fcmVhZF9yZWcoY3R4LCBhZGRyKTsKLQkJZmllbGRfdmFsdWUgPSBn ZXRfcmVnX2ZpZWxkX3ZhbHVlX2V4KHJlZ192YWwsIG1hc2ssIHNoaWZ0KTsKLQkJY291bnQgKz0g aW50ZXJ2YWxfdXM7Ci0KLQl9IHdoaWxlIChmaWVsZF92YWx1ZSAhPSBjb25kaXRpb25fdmFsdWUg JiYgY291bnQgPD0gdGltZW91dF91cyk7Ci0KLQlBU1NFUlQoY291bnQgPD0gdGltZW91dF91cyk7 Ci0KLQlyZXR1cm4gY291bnQgPD0gdGltZW91dF91czsKLX0KLQotI2RlZmluZSB3YWl0X3JlZyhj dHgsIGluc3Rfb2Zmc2V0LCByZWdfbmFtZSwgcmVnX2ZpZWxkLCBjb25kaXRpb25fdmFsdWUpXAot CXdhaXRfcmVnX2Z1bmMoXAotCQljdHgsXAotCQltbSMjcmVnX25hbWUgKyBpbnN0X29mZnNldCAr IERDRV9CQVNFLmluc3RhbmNlWzBdLnNlZ21lbnRbbW0jI3JlZ19uYW1lIyNfQkFTRV9JRFhdLFwK LQkJcmVnX25hbWUgIyMgX18gIyMgcmVnX2ZpZWxkICMjIF9NQVNLLFwKLQkJcmVnX25hbWUgIyMg X18gIyMgcmVnX2ZpZWxkICMjIF9fU0hJRlQsXAotCQljb25kaXRpb25fdmFsdWUsXAotCQkyMDAw MCxcCi0JCTIwMDAwMCkKLQogLyoqKioqKioqKioqKioqKioqKioqKioqKioqKioqKioqKioqKioq CiAgKiBQb3dlciBQbGF5IChQUCkgaW50ZXJmYWNlcwogICoqKioqKioqKioqKioqKioqKioqKioq KioqKioqKioqKioqKioqLwotLSAKMi45LjQKCl9f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fCmFtZC1nZnggbWFpbGluZyBsaXN0CmFtZC1nZnhAbGlzdHMuZnJl ZWRlc2t0b3Aub3JnCmh0dHBzOi8vbGlzdH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Glu Zm8vYW1kLWdmeAo=